What are Diamond Simulants? Diamond simulants are gemstones that resemble diamond simulants read in appearance but differ in composition and characteristics. They are often used as alternatives to natural diamonds due to their affordability and accessibility. Unlike natural diamonds, which are formed deep within the Earth over millions of years under intense pressure and heat, simulants are created in laboratories or occur naturally in forms that mimic diamond’s optical properties.
